Under 14s
Wingham won the toss and chose to field first against Taree West Heat. Taree West were looking comfortable at the crease and soon had the runs flowing until a change in the bowling started to turn things Wingham's way.
Cae Allan (1 for 25) snared the breakthrough wicket and from there wickets started to quickly fall. Jacob Russell (2 for 5) was on a hat trick but couldn't snatch the elusive third wicket.
Jack Baker (2 for 2) also picked up two wickets, but the pick of the bowlers was Cooper Walker with 3 for 20 from three overs. At the end of innings Taree West were 8-131.
Wingham found it hard to build batting partnerships with wickets falling regularly.
Jackson Barry top scored with 17, while Cae Allan 11 and Oran Shepherd 10 made notable contributions as Wingham Were dismissed for 67.
Next week Wingham play Oxley Insurance Brokers Great Lakes.
Representative news
In representative news five members of the Wingham Under 14s were selected in the Manning Striped Marlins for Mid North Coast Inter-district cricket.
These included Cae Allen, Jackson Barry, Lachlan Dawson, Callum Taylor and Harry Thomas.
Notable performances over the last two weeks included 3 for 11 from Cae Allen, 1 for 20 from Callum Taylor and 1 for 23 from Harry Thomas.
Wingham's Under 12 representatives have also been fortunate to enjoy two weekends of cricket with Oscar Platt bowling superbly with 3/42 and a direct hit run out.
Shawn Griffin kept commendably while Arabella Roohan helped her side out of trouble with an eighth wicket partnership of 56.
